What exactly leaves Arbitrum as SOL?
SOL is a contract representation on Arbitrum with 9 decimals at 0x2bcC6D6CdBbDC0a4071e48bb3B969b06B3330c07. ETH, not SOL, pays gas unless both symbols are the same. On an Arbitrum source, the Nitro sequencer records L2 execution before Ethereum settlement completes; ETH funds gas and ERC-20 inputs can need approval. Native SOL leaves a Solana account through a signed transaction and pays the fee; wrapped or tokenized SOL uses a token account or external contract instead.
What exactly arrives on Tron as DAI?
DAI is a contract representation on Tron with 18 decimals at TUm5Khy1QovxuU4dGePAxFyvzKjs31C56S. TRX, not DAI, pays gas unless both symbols are the same. A Tron receipt belongs to a T-address as native TRX or the quoted TRC-20 contract; later activity consumes Tron resources or TRX fees. The receiving wallet must recognize the exact destination DAI contract. Peg intent does not guarantee that a bridged representation has the same liquidity or issuer path.
